Australian spectacled pelicans are strange birds. This is not only because of their appearance, but mainly because of their unusual way of life. Most of the time they live rather contemplatively in the coastal regions, but when there are floods in the inland desert every 5, 10 or 20 years, tens of thousands fly there to breed. This film accompanies the spectacled pelicans on their journey and shows the inhospitable desert as an important habitat for these water birds.

Director: Annette Scheurich

In her capacity as Managing Director of Marco Polo Film AG, Heidelberg, Annette Scheurich is responsible for development and production of documentaries. She began producing nature films in 1984 and with her filmmaker husband Klaus Scheurich is co-founder of the production company Marco Polo Film. She has been working as author and producer of numerous documentaries mainly in the genres nature film, science and adventure. Many of those films have won multiple awards. She works for national and international broadcasters and produced the award winning documentary “The White Diamond” directed by Werner Herzog.
